Q&A About Compressor Repair
1. How do I know if my aircond compressor is the problem?
Answer: If the air is no longer cold, the unit is making odd noises, or the compressor doesn’t start at all, it could be the issue. It's best to get it checked early before it causes more damage.
2. Can I still run my aircond if the compressor is faulty?
Answer: It’s not a good idea. A damaged compressor can strain other parts of the system. If you suspect a problem, it’s better to stop using it and arrange for an aircond compressor repair.
3. Should I repair or replace the compressor?
Answer: If the problem is small and picked up early, a repair can do the job. But if the compressor is already in bad shape or the aircond is nearing the end of its lifespan, replacement might be the better call to avoid more issues later on. A proper check will help you decide.
4. How long does aircond compressor repair usually take?
Answer: It depends on the issue. Some jobs can be done in an hour or two. If parts need changing or the unit is hard to access, it’ll take longer. The condition of the compressor makes all the difference.
5. What usually causes compressor damage?
Answer: Most of the time it’s due to low gas, clogged filters, or lack of regular servicing. These problems can go unnoticed until it’s too late. Regular servicing helps catch early signs and reduces the chance of needing major aircond compressor repair later on.
